Maltese

[edit]

Etymology

[edit]

    Inherited from Arabic نَحْنُ (naḥnu). Compare Egyptian Arabic احنا (eḥna).

    Pronoun

    [edit]

    aħna

    1. we (first-person plural subject pronoun)

    Inflection

    [edit]
    Inflected forms of aħna
    positive aħna
    negative maħniex
    possessive pronoun tagħna
    basic suffix -na
    direct object suffix -na
    indirect object suffix -lna
